| dc.description | In the standard model, CP asymmetries in the $B^\pm \to π^\pm K$ channels are about 2% based on perturbative calculation. Rescattering effects might enhance it to at most (20-25)%. We show that lepton-number-violating $λ'$ couplings in supersymmetric models are capable of enhancing it to as large as 100%. Upcoming B factories will test this scenario. | |
